SECTION 3: TRACTOR SET-UP
Shipping BraceRemoval
_,
WARNING:
Make sure the riding mower's
engine
is off, set the
parking
brake
and
remove the ignition key before removing the
shipping brace.
Locate the shipping brace, if present, and warning
tag found on the right side of the cutting deck.
While holding the discharge chute with your left
hand, remove the shipping brace with your right
hand by grasping it between your thumb and index
finger and rotating it clockwise.
WARNING:
The shipping brace, used for
packaging purposes only, must be removed
and discarded
before operating
your riding
mower.

Tire Pressure
_,
WARNING:
Maximum tire pressure under
any circumstances
is 30 psi. Equal tire
pressure should be maintained at all times.
The tires on your unit may be over-inflated for shipping
purposes. Reduce the tire pressure before operating
the tractor. Recommended operating tire pressure is
approximately 10 p.s.i for the rear tires & 14 p.s.i, for
the front tires. Check sidewall of tire for maximum p.s.i.
Attaching theBatteryCables
NOTE:
The positive battery terminal is marked Pos.
(+). The negative battery terminal is marked Neg. (-).
The positive cable (heavy red wire) is secured to
the positive battery terminal (+) with a hex bolt and
hex nut at the factory. Make certain that the red
rubber boot covers the terminal to help protect it
from corrosion.
Remove the carriage bolt and hex nut from the
negative cable.
Remove the black plastic cover, if present, from the
negative battery terminal and attach the negative
cable (heavy black wire) to the negative battery
terminal (-) with the bolt and hex nut.
Make certain the hold-down rod is in position over
the battery, securing it in place.
NOTE:
If the battery is put into service after the date
shown on top/side of battery, charge the battery as
instructed on page 26 of this manual prior to operating
the tractor.
GasandOilFill-up
The gasoline tank is located under the fender and has a
capacity of three and-a-half gallons. Remove the fuel
cap by turning it counterclockwise.
Use only clean,
fresh (no more than 30 days old), unleaded gasoline.
Fill the tank no higher than four inches below the top of
the filler neck to allow space for fuel expansion.
WARNING:
Use
extreme
care
when
handling
gasoline.
Gasoline
is
extremely
flammable
and the vapors
are explosive.
Never fuel
machine
indoors
or while
the
engine
is
hot
or
running.
Extinguish
cigarettes, cigars, pipes, and other sources of
ignition.
IMPORTANT: Your tractor is shipped with oil in the
engine. However, you MUST check the oil level before
operating. Refer to Checking the 0il Levelon page 19 for
detailed instructions. Be careful not to overfill.
